Weapons sold at Don's Guns linked to later crimes | The Indianapolis Star | IndyStar.com: "Don Davis, the colorful local gun-shop owner who 'just loves to sell guns,' is under scrutiny again, not for how many guns he sells, but for who ends up with them.
For the second time in recent years, a statistical analysis cited Don's Guns and Galleries in Indianapolis as a leading purveyor of guns later linked to crimes.
An investigation by The Washington Post found Don's ranked third among the country's firearm retailers, with 1,910 crime-related guns traced back to the shop in the past four years.
An earlier study by a gun-control organization found that Don's ranked second in such sales from 1996 to 2000, with 2,294 guns turning up illegally."
